How To Eat Purple Cabbage

How To Eat Purple Cabbage

Purple cabbage is not only a beautiful addition to any dish, but it is also packed with nutrients and health benefits. If you're wondering how to incorporate this vibrant vegetable into your diet, look no further. Here are some creative and delicious ways to enjoy purple cabbage:

1. Purple Cabbage Slaw

One of the most popular ways to enjoy purple cabbage is by making a crunchy and colorful slaw. Simply shred the cabbage and toss it with some shredded carrots, thinly sliced red onions, and a tangy vinaigrette. This makes for a refreshing side dish or a topping for tacos and sandwiches.

2. Purple Cabbage Salad

For a lighter option, consider making a purple cabbage salad. Combine thinly sliced cabbage with some fresh greens, such as spinach or arugula, and add in some sliced apples or pears for a touch of sweetness. Top it off with a zesty citrus dressing for a burst of flavor.

3. Purple Cabbage Stir-Fry

Add a pop of color and crunch to your stir-fry by incorporating purple cabbage. Simply chop the cabbage into bite-sized pieces and toss it into your favorite stir-fry recipe. It pairs well with a variety of proteins and adds a delightful texture to the dish.

4. Purple Cabbage Wraps

For a fun and creative way to enjoy purple cabbage, use the leaves as wraps for your favorite fillings. Whether you opt for a vegetarian filling with quinoa and roasted vegetables or a protein-packed option with grilled chicken, the sturdy cabbage leaves make for a nutritious and low-carb alternative to traditional wraps.

5. Purple Cabbage Soup

Warm up with a hearty and nutritious purple cabbage soup. Combine chopped cabbage with other vegetables, such as carrots, celery, and tomatoes, and simmer them in a flavorful broth. This comforting soup is perfect for chilly days and can be enjoyed as a light meal or a starter.

6. Purple Cabbage Tacos

Elevate your taco game by using purple cabbage as a crunchy and colorful topping. Simply shred the cabbage and use it as a fresh and vibrant addition to your favorite tacos. Whether you prefer fish tacos, chicken tacos, or vegetarian options, the purple cabbage adds a delightful texture and a pop of color.

7. Purple Cabbage Smoothie

If you’re feeling adventurous, consider adding purple cabbage to your smoothies. While it may seem unconventional, the mild flavor of the cabbage pairs well with fruits like berries, bananas, and pineapples. Plus, it’s a great way to sneak in some extra nutrients into your morning routine.

FAQ:
What are some ways to prepare and cook purple cabbage?
Purple cabbage can be prepared and cooked in various ways. You can shred it and use it raw in salads, pickle it for a tangy side dish, sauté it with other vegetables, or even roast it in the oven for a crispy texture.
Can purple cabbage be eaten raw?
Yes, purple cabbage can be eaten raw. It adds a vibrant color and crunchy texture to salads and slaws. Just make sure to wash and thinly slice or shred the cabbage before adding it to your dish.
What are some recipes that feature purple cabbage as the main ingredient?
Purple cabbage can be the star of dishes like coleslaw, stir-fries, and even as a topping for tacos. You can also use it in fermented foods like sauerkraut for a delicious and probiotic-rich condiment.
Are there any health benefits to eating purple cabbage?
Yes, purple cabbage is packed with nutrients and antioxidants. It’s a great source of vitamin C, vitamin K, and fiber. It also contains anthocyanins, which are compounds that give it its vibrant color and have been linked to various health benefits.
Can purple cabbage be used in smoothies or juices?
Absolutely! Purple cabbage can be added to smoothies or juices for an extra boost of nutrients and a beautiful purple hue. Just make sure to blend it well with other fruits and vegetables to balance out its slightly peppery flavor.
